Millwright Responsibilities:

  • Maintain and repair cone and jaw crushers crusher screens conveyor belts rollers and drive units.
  • Rebuild and maintain industrial slurry pumps.

  • Perform welding metal fabrication and pipe fitting tasks.

  • Ensure compliance with MSHA and company safety policies.

  • Maintain accurate records of repairs maintenance and inspections.

  • Collaborate with mill operations to minimize downtime and maximize efficiency.
  • Be flexible with work hours to support unplanned maintenance or project needs.

Required Qualifications:

  • Experience with rod and ball milling is required.

  • Strong mechanical aptitude and industrial machinery experience.

  • Skilled in using hand tools welding equipment and diagnostic instruments.
  • Ability to read blueprints schematics and technical drawings (preferred).
  • Proven problem-solving abilities and attention to detail.

  • Physically able to lift/move heavy equipment and work in a physically demanding environment.

  • Previous industrial or mining experience is a plus.
